How much does a metal-refining furnace operators and tenders make in Wisconsin?▼
The median metal-refining furnace operators and tenders salary in Wisconsin is $47,980 per year ($23.07/hr). This is 14% below the national median of $55,770. Salaries range from $36,310 to $69,630.

Can a metal-refining furnace operators and tenders afford to live in Wisconsin?▼
At the median salary of $47,980, a metal-refining furnace operators and tenders in Wisconsin would take home approximately $3,258/month after taxes. With median 2-bedroom rent at $1,412/month, that's 43.3% of take-home pay going to housing. This exceeds the recommended 30% guideline.
